my roomate is stuffin 37's on his prerunner 07 silverado. but it has a custom long travel kit.

his 35s rubbed on turns, (35/12.5-17) but not till the very end of the steering radius. BUT he was on a total chaos mid travel suspension kit. basically a 5" lift in the front and 2" in the rear is what his suspension translates into. He also has fiberglass front fenders and tube bumper. These pics are his old setup, il get some of it on the 37s soon.
